首页
API市场
每日免费
OneAPI
xAPI
易源定价
技术博客
易源易彩
帮助中心
控制台
登录/注册
技术博客
mhWaveEdit音乐编辑软件详解
mhWaveEdit音乐编辑软件详解
作者:
万维易源
2024-08-23
mhWaveEdit
音乐编辑
轻量级
音频文件
### 摘要 mhWaveEdit是一款轻量级且功能强大的图形化音乐编辑软件,它不仅支持播放和录制声音文件,还特别适合处理大型音频文件。由于其便携性和高效性能,mhWaveEdit成为了音乐制作人和音频编辑爱好者的首选工具。为了帮助用户更好地理解和运用该软件,本文提供了丰富的代码示例,旨在增强文章的实用性和可操作性。 ### 关键词 mhWaveEdit, 音乐编辑, 轻量级, 音频文件, 代码示例 ## 一、mhWaveEdit概述 ### 1.1 mhWaveEdit的基本功能 mhWaveEdit作为一款集多种功能于一身的音乐编辑软件,其核心优势在于其轻量级的设计与强大的编辑能力。对于音乐制作人而言,mhWaveEdit不仅能够轻松播放和录制各种声音文件,更重要的是,它能够高效地处理大型音频文件,这在同类软件中是极为罕见的。例如,在处理长达数小时的录音文件时,mhWaveEdit依然能够保持流畅的操作体验,这对于专业音乐制作人来说是一个巨大的福音。 此外,mhWaveEdit还内置了一系列实用的功能,如剪切、复制、粘贴等基本编辑操作,以及更高级的特效处理功能,包括但不限于降噪、均衡器调整等。这些功能使得mhWaveEdit不仅仅局限于简单的音频剪辑,而是能够满足从初学者到专业人士的各种需求。 为了进一步提升用户体验,本文特别加入了丰富的代码示例,帮助用户更好地掌握mhWaveEdit的使用技巧。无论是想要快速上手的新手,还是希望深入挖掘软件潜力的专业人士,都能从中受益匪浅。 ### 1.2 mhWaveEdit的界面介绍 打开mhWaveEdit的第一眼,用户会被其简洁直观的界面所吸引。软件采用了经典的布局设计,将所有常用功能整合在一个清晰明了的界面上,确保即使是初次接触的用户也能迅速找到所需工具。 主界面通常分为几个主要区域:波形显示区、控制面板、效果面板以及文件管理器。波形显示区占据了大部分空间,用于展示音频文件的波形图,用户可以通过缩放和平移来查看不同部分的细节。控制面板则包含了播放、暂停、停止等基本操作按钮,以及音量调节旋钮等。效果面板允许用户添加和调整各种音频效果,比如回声、混响等。最后,文件管理器方便用户导入、导出文件,以及进行批量处理。 整体而言,mhWaveEdit的界面设计既美观又实用,无论是在日常使用还是进行复杂项目时,都能够为用户提供极佳的操作体验。 ## 二、mhWaveEdit的音频处理能力 ### 2.1 mhWaveEdit的录制功能 在音乐创作的世界里,捕捉灵感的瞬间至关重要。mhWaveEdit的录制功能正是为此而生。无论是即兴演奏还是现场录音,mhWaveEdit都能确保每一次录制都达到专业水准。软件支持多种音频输入设备,用户可以根据自己的需求选择最适合的麦克风或乐器接口。更重要的是,mhWaveEdit在录制过程中几乎不产生延迟,这意味着音乐家可以实时听到自己的演奏,极大地提高了创作效率。 **示例代码:** ```plaintext // 启动录制 mhWaveEdit.startRecording("input_device_id"); // 停止录制并保存文件 mhWaveEdit.stopRecording("output_file_path"); ``` 这样的代码示例不仅简单易懂,而且非常实用。即便是初学者也能迅速掌握如何使用mhWaveEdit进行高质量的录音。而对于专业人士来说,这些代码更是提供了无限的可能性,让他们能够更加专注于创作本身,而不是被技术细节所困扰。 ### 2.2 mhWaveEdit的播放功能 播放功能是任何音乐编辑软件不可或缺的一部分,mhWaveEdit在这方面同样表现出色。它支持多种音频格式,包括常见的MP3、WAV等,确保用户可以无缝播放几乎所有类型的音频文件。不仅如此,mhWaveEdit还提供了精确到毫秒级别的播放控制,这对于需要精细编辑的场景尤为重要。 **示例代码:** ```plaintext // 加载音频文件 mhWaveEdit.loadAudioFile("audio_file_path"); // 开始播放 mhWaveEdit.play(); // 暂停播放 mhWaveEdit.pause(); // 设置播放位置(毫秒) mhWaveEdit.seekTo(5000); // 跳转至5秒处 ``` 通过这些简洁明了的代码示例,用户可以轻松实现对音频文件的精确控制。无论是快速预览还是深入编辑,mhWaveEdit都能提供卓越的播放体验。对于那些追求完美音质的音乐制作人来说,mhWaveEdit的播放功能无疑是他们不可或缺的伙伴。 ## 三、mhWaveEdit的优点 ### 3.1 mhWaveEdit的轻量级特点 在当今这个快节奏的时代,轻量级软件因其占用资源少、启动速度快而备受青睐。mhWaveEdit正是这样一款软件,它以其轻巧的身躯承载着强大的音乐编辑功能。尽管市面上不乏功能繁多的音频编辑软件,但它们往往因为体积庞大而牺牲了运行效率。mhWaveEdit却能在保证高性能的同时,保持软件的轻盈,这一点尤为难能可贵。 **示例代码:** ```plaintext // 快速启动mhWaveEdit mhWaveEdit.launch(); // 打开一个大型音频文件 mhWaveEdit.openLargeAudioFile("large_audio_file.wav"); ``` 这段简短的代码示例展示了mhWaveEdit启动和加载大型音频文件的速度之快。即便是面对数十兆甚至上百兆的音频文件,mhWaveEdit也能在几秒钟内完成加载,让用户迅速进入工作状态。这种高效的性能背后,是mhWaveEdit团队对软件优化的不懈追求。他们精心设计每一行代码,确保软件在执行复杂任务时仍能保持流畅。 mhWaveEdit的轻量级特点不仅体现在启动速度上,更体现在其对系统资源的精打细算。这意味着即使是在配置较低的电脑上,mhWaveEdit也能发挥出色的表现。对于那些经常需要外出工作的音乐制作人来说,mhWaveEdit无疑是最理想的伴侣——无论身处何地,都能随时开启创作之旅。 ### 3.2 mhWaveEdit的便携性 便携性是衡量一款软件是否优秀的另一个重要指标。mhWaveEdit深知这一点,并将其作为软件设计的核心理念之一。它不仅体积小巧,而且支持安装在多种操作系统上,无论是Windows、Mac OS还是Linux,mhWaveEdit都能轻松应对。更重要的是,mhWaveEdit还支持绿色版,无需安装即可直接运行,这让它成为移动办公的理想选择。 **示例代码:** ```plaintext // 创建mhWaveEdit的便携版本 mhWaveEdit.createPortableVersion("path_to_portable_folder"); // 在另一台电脑上运行便携版本 mhWaveEdit.runPortableVersion(); ``` 通过上述代码,用户可以轻松创建mhWaveEdit的便携版本,并在不同的电脑之间自由携带。这意味着无论是在工作室、咖啡厅还是旅途中,只要有USB闪存盘,就能随时随地开始音乐创作。mhWaveEdit的这一特性极大地扩展了音乐制作人的工作范围,让创意不再受限于地点。 mhWaveEdit的便携性不仅体现在物理层面,更体现在其对用户习惯的尊重。软件内置了多种自定义选项,允许用户根据个人喜好调整界面布局和快捷键设置。这种高度的个性化定制能力,让mhWaveEdit能够更好地融入每一位用户的创作流程之中,成为他们不可或缺的得力助手。 ## 四、mhWaveEdit的实践应用 ### 4.1 mhWaveEdit在音乐编辑中的应用 在音乐创作的过程中,每一个细节都至关重要。mhWaveEdit凭借其卓越的音乐编辑功能,成为了众多音乐制作人的首选工具。无论是简单的音频剪辑还是复杂的混音工程,mhWaveEdit都能提供精准的支持。它不仅支持基本的剪切、复制、粘贴等功能,还拥有丰富的特效处理选项,如降噪、均衡器调整等,这些功能让音乐创作者能够尽情发挥创意,打造出独一无二的声音作品。 **示例代码:** ```plaintext // 加载音频文件 mhWaveEdit.loadAudioFile("song.wav"); // 应用降噪效果 mhWaveEdit.applyNoiseReduction(); // 调整均衡器设置 mhWaveEdit.adjustEqualizer("bass_boost"); // 导出最终音频文件 mhWaveEdit.exportAudioFile("final_song.wav"); ``` 通过这些简洁而实用的代码示例,即使是初学者也能迅速掌握mhWaveEdit的核心编辑技巧。而对于经验丰富的音乐制作人来说,mhWaveEdit提供的高级功能更是让他们能够深入探索声音的无限可能。无论是修复老旧录音带中的杂音,还是为新曲目增添层次感,mhWaveEdit都能提供强有力的支持,帮助音乐人将心中的旋律转化为真实可感的艺术作品。 ### 4.2 mhWaveEdit在音频处理中的应用 音频处理是音乐制作中不可或缺的一环,mhWaveEdit在这方面的表现同样令人印象深刻。它不仅能够高效地处理大型音频文件,还能确保在处理过程中保持音质的纯净度。这对于那些需要处理长时间录音的专业人士来说,无疑是一大福音。mhWaveEdit支持多种音频格式,无论是常见的MP3、WAV还是其他特殊格式,都能轻松应对。 **示例代码:** ```plaintext // 加载大型音频文件 mhWaveEdit.loadLargeAudioFile("concert_recording.wav"); // 分割音频文件 mhWaveEdit.splitAudioFile("track_1.wav", "track_2.wav"); // 合并多个音频片段 mhWaveEdit.mergeAudioFiles("track_1.wav", "track_2.wav", "merged_track.wav"); // 应用混响效果 mhWaveEdit.applyReverb("hall_reverb"); ``` 借助这些易于理解的代码示例,mhWaveEdit不仅简化了音频处理的过程,还极大地提升了工作效率。无论是分割长录音文件以便于管理和编辑,还是合并多个音频片段创造连贯的故事线,mhWaveEdit都能提供流畅的操作体验。更重要的是,mhWaveEdit在处理音频时始终保持音质的高保真度,确保最终作品能够达到专业级的标准。对于追求极致音质的音乐制作人来说,mhWaveEdit无疑是他们最可靠的伙伴。 ## 五、mhWaveEdit的实用技巧 ### 5.1 mhWaveEdit的代码示例 在深入了解mhWaveEdit的各项功能之后,我们来到了实践操作的部分。为了让用户能够更加熟练地掌握这款软件,本节将提供一系列实用的代码示例,帮助大家快速上手并发挥mhWaveEdit的最大潜力。 #### 示例1: 使用mhWaveEdit进行基本编辑操作 ```plaintext // 加载音频文件 mhWaveEdit.loadAudioFile("original_track.wav"); // 剪切音频片段 (从第10秒到第20秒) mhWaveEdit.cutAudioSegment(10000, 20000); // 粘贴剪切的音频片段到第30秒的位置 mhWaveEdit.pasteAudioSegment(30000); // 保存编辑后的音频文件 mhWaveEdit.saveEditedAudio("edited_track.wav"); ``` 这段代码示例展示了如何使用mhWaveEdit进行基本的音频剪辑操作。通过简单的几行代码,用户就能够实现音频片段的剪切、粘贴,并将编辑后的结果保存下来。这对于需要快速修改音频文件的场景来说非常有用。 #### 示例2: 利用mhWaveEdit进行高级特效处理 ```plaintext // 加载音频文件 mhWaveEdit.loadAudioFile("live_performance.wav"); // 应用降噪效果 mhWaveEdit.applyNoiseReduction(); // 调整均衡器设置 (增加低音) mhWaveEdit.adjustEqualizer("bass_boost"); // 添加混响效果 (模拟大厅环境) mhWaveEdit.applyReverb("hall_reverb"); // 导出最终音频文件 mhWaveEdit.exportAudioFile("enhanced_performance.wav"); ``` 在这个示例中,我们利用mhWaveEdit的强大特效处理功能,对一段现场表演的录音进行了全面的优化。通过降噪、调整均衡器以及添加混响效果,原本嘈杂的录音变得清晰而富有层次感。这对于追求高品质音频的专业音乐制作人来说,是一个不可或缺的工具。 通过这些具体的代码示例,我们可以看到mhWaveEdit不仅在基本编辑操作方面表现出色,更在高级特效处理方面有着不可替代的作用。无论是新手还是专业人士,都能从中受益匪浅。 ### 5.2 mhWaveEdit的使用技巧 掌握了基本的代码示例后,接下来我们将分享一些使用mhWaveEdit的小技巧,帮助你更加高效地使用这款软件。 #### 技巧1: 快速定位音频片段 在处理大型音频文件时,快速定位到特定的音频片段是非常重要的。mhWaveEdit提供了多种方法来实现这一点: - **使用时间标记**: 在播放过程中,你可以随时设置时间标记,以便快速跳转到之前标记的位置。 - **利用搜索功能**: 如果你知道某个片段的大致时间点,可以直接在搜索框中输入时间,mhWaveEdit会自动跳转到相应位置。 #### 技巧2: 自定义快捷键提高效率 为了提高工作效率,mhWaveEdit允许用户自定义快捷键。你可以根据自己的习惯设置常用的编辑命令,比如剪切、复制、粘贴等。这样一来,在实际操作中就可以通过快捷键快速完成任务,大大节省了时间。 #### 技巧3: 利用批处理功能批量处理文件 当你需要对多个音频文件进行相同的编辑操作时,mhWaveEdit的批处理功能就显得尤为重要。只需设置一次编辑参数,软件就会自动对选定的所有文件进行处理,极大地提高了工作效率。 通过以上技巧的应用,你将能够更加高效地使用mhWaveEdit,无论是处理简单的音频剪辑任务还是复杂的音乐制作项目,都能游刃有余。希望这些实用的技巧能够帮助你在音乐创作的道路上越走越远。 ## 六、总结 通过对mhWaveEdit的全面解析,我们不仅领略了这款轻量级音乐编辑软件的强大功能,还深入了解了它在音乐创作和音频处理中的广泛应用。mhWaveEdit以其出色的性能和便捷的操作,成为了音乐制作人和音频编辑爱好者的得力助手。无论是处理大型音频文件,还是进行精细的音乐编辑,mhWaveEdit都能提供卓越的支持。丰富的代码示例不仅增强了文章的实用性和可操作性,更为用户提供了快速上手的途径。总之,mhWaveEdit不仅是一款功能齐全的音乐编辑工具,更是激发创意、实现梦想的重要伙伴。
最新资讯
Uno Platform 6.0:颠覆传统的性能提升与工具链革新
加载文章中...
客服热线
客服热线请拨打
400-998-8033
客服QQ
联系微信
客服微信
商务微信
意见反馈